Description

The ATV68C15N4 is a variable frequency drive rated at 110 kW for 400-500 V industrial electrical systems within the Altivar product range. Manufactured by Schneider Electric, this drive is engineered to regulate electric motor speed and torque, optimizing energy consumption and operational control in heavy-duty machinery.

The ATV68C15N4 provides precise motor management for complex industrial processes, helping to reduce mechanical wear and improve overall system efficiency. The unit weighs 45.00 kg and is constructed to withstand demanding operating environments. As an obsolete lifecycle product, it is utilized primarily for legacy system maintenance, replacement, and direct hardware support in established automation setups.

Installation Guidelines

  • Mount the ATV68C15N4 vertically inside an adequately sized industrial cabinet or enclosure, allowing sufficient clearance above and below the unit for natural airflow.
  • Ensure the supply voltage matches the 400-500 V rating before making electrical connections.
  • Connect all motor and power cables securely to the designated terminals in accordance with local electrical codes and wiring diagrams.
  • Implement proper grounding techniques and shield control cables to minimize electromagnetic interference (EMI) within the control panel.
